Overnight Oats: Prep Tonight, Enjoy Tomorrow
Imagine waking up to a ready-to-eat, nutritious breakfast that kids will love – that’s the magic of overnight oats. This simple, make-ahead breakfast solution is perfect for busy mornings, allowing parents to prep a healthy meal the night before.
Basic Overnight Oats Recipe
To make basic overnight oats, you’ll need rolled oats, milk, and a sweetener like honey or maple syrup. Mix these ingredients in a jar or container, then refrigerate overnight. In the morning, you’ll have a creamy, delicious breakfast ready to go. You can customize this simple breakfast recipe by adding your favorite fruits or nuts.
Three Flavor Variations Kids Will Love
Kids will enjoy the variety that overnight oats offer. Try these three flavor variations:
– Strawberry Cheesecake: Add fresh strawberries and a drizzle of honey
– Peanut Butter Banana: Mix in mashed banana and peanut butter
– Cinnamon Apple: Add diced apple and a sprinkle of cinnamon
These kid-friendly breakfast ideas are sure to be a hit with your little ones.
Make-Ahead Tips and Storage Solutions
One of the best things about overnight oats is their make-ahead convenience. Prepare multiple jars on the weekend or one night for the next day. Store them in the refrigerator for up to three days. This prep ahead strategy saves time during the week and ensures a healthy breakfast every day.

Egg-cellent Protein Power: Quick Breakfast Bites
Egg-cellent protein power is just what kids need to tackle the school day with energy. Eggs are an excellent source of protein and can be prepared in various ways to keep breakfast interesting. Whether you’re looking for a grab-and-go option or a quick microwave meal, eggs are a versatile ingredient that can be tailored to suit your family’s tastes.
Muffin Tin Egg Cups for the Week
Preparing muffin tin egg cups on the weekend can provide a quick breakfast solution for the entire week. Simply crack eggs into muffin tins, add your choice of vegetables, cheese, or meats, and bake until set. These protein-packed bites can be refrigerated or frozen for later use, making them a convenient grab-and-go breakfast option.
5-Minute Microwave Egg Scrambles
For busy mornings, a 5-minute microwave egg scramble is a lifesaver. Crack an egg into a microwave-safe container, add a splash of milk, and your favorite fillings (like diced ham or spinach), then microwave until the eggs are cooked through. This quick and easy breakfast is a great way to get protein on the table fast.
Protein-Packed Additions for Lasting Energy
To keep kids full until lunchtime, consider adding protein-packed ingredients to your egg breakfasts. Options like diced bacon, sausage, or black beans not only add protein but also flavor. For a vegetarian option, adding beans or tofu can provide a similar protein boost.
Grab-and-Go Breakfast Wraps and Sandwiches
Quick, nutritious breakfasts are within reach with grab-and-go wraps and sandwiches. These breakfast on-the-go options are perfect for busy mornings when time is scarce but nutrition is still a priority.
Freezer-Friendly Breakfast Wrap Recipes
Preparing freezer-friendly breakfast wraps in advance can be a game-changer for rushed mornings. Simply assemble your wraps with your choice of fillings, wrap them individually, and freeze. When you’re ready, thaw overnight in the fridge or quickly microwave them. Consider using whole wheat or whole grain wraps for added nutrition.
Healthy Fillings That Keep Kids Full Until Lunch
Choosing the right fillings is crucial for keeping kids satisfied until lunchtime. Opt for a mix of protein, healthy fats, and complex carbohydrates. Some great options include scrambled eggs, turkey sausage, black beans, avocado, and cheese. Adding veggies like spinach or bell peppers can also boost nutritional value.
Assembly Line Techniques for Multiple Servings
To streamline your morning routine, consider using assembly line techniques to prepare multiple servings at once. Lay out all your ingredients and wrapping materials, then assemble the wraps in an assembly line fashion. This method not only saves time but also ensures consistency across your breakfast wraps.
